What is Ferrous Sulfate?

Ferrous sulfate is an iron supplement that is commonly prescribed to individuals suffering from iron deficiency anemia. It is a type of iron salt that is readily absorbed by the body, making it an excellent choice for replenishing iron levels. Ferrous sulfate is typically available in tablet or liquid form and can be found over-the-counter or by prescription.

How Does Ferrous Sulfate Work?

Iron is an essential mineral that plays a crucial role in the production of hemoglobin, the protein in red blood cells that carries oxygen throughout the body. When the body lacks sufficient iron, it cannot produce enough hemoglobin, leading to anemia. Ferrous sulfate provides the necessary iron to help restore healthy hemoglobin levels, thereby alleviating the symptoms of anemia.

Once ingested, ferrous sulfate is absorbed in the gastrointestinal tract and transported to the bone marrow, where it is used to produce new red blood cells. This process not only helps in increasing hemoglobin levels but also improves overall energy levels and vitality.

How to Take Ferrous Sulfate

To maximize the benefits of ferrous sulfate, it is essential to take it correctly. Here are some tips:

– Follow Dosage Instructions: Always adhere to the recommended dosage provided by your healthcare provider or as indicated on the product label.
– Take with Vitamin C: Consuming ferrous sulfate with a source of vitamin C, such as orange juice, can enhance iron absorption.
– Avoid Certain Foods: Certain foods and drinks, such as dairy products, coffee, and tea, can inhibit iron absorption. It’s best to avoid these around the time you take your supplement.

Potential Side Effects

While ferrous sulfate is generally safe for most individuals, some may experience side effects, including constipation, nausea, or stomach upset. If side effects persist or worsen, it is essential to consult with a healthcare professional.
